| Via
Lido Plaza, an 86,000 square foot neighborhood shopping center
complex located at the entrance to the world famous Balboa
Peninsula in Newport Beach, California, has been serving
the shopping needs of Newport Beach residents for over 60
years.
Anchored by Vons Pavilions supermarket, Bank of America
and Laguna Drugs, Via Lido Plaza is also home to the historic
Lido Theatre, a 70-year-old, 622 seat art deco Movie Theatre
with a one of a kind interior mural painting depicting underwater
aquatic life. By playing first run art films and hosting
several film festivals - including the famous Newport Beach
Film Festival - the Lido Regency Theatre attracts consumers
from all over Southern California.
Dining options at Via
Lido Plaza include Woody's Diner,
Regatta Café, Starbucks, and Z Pizza. In addition,
the historic Griffith Building offers highly desirable second
level courtyard style offices with retail shops below at
street level. Open court yard seating, cascading fountains
and picturesque hanging flower basket walkways help to create
an intimate ambiance for the patrons of Via Lido Plaza to
enjoy the pleasant environment of the Newport Beach harbor
area.
Located at the gateway to the Balboa Peninsula at the
Southeast Corner of Via Lido and Newport Boulevard, Via
Lido Plaza is perfectly positioned to serve the retailing
needs of the Balboa Peninsula, West Newport and East Costa
Mesa communities.
